Behind the scenes story for “Falling for the Porches of Middleport” poster

How did the poster featuring some of the many wonderful and welcoming porches in Middleport, NY get made? Photographer Gretchen Schweigert talks about how she photographed some of them and what they mean to her in this YouTube video.  The poster is available for a suggested $5 donation. Funds raised will be used to publish a book about the history of the Village of Middleport written by former Village Historian Anna Wallace. “Life in the Village” stars Middleport residents

Life in the Village is just a bit slower and simpler… It’s one of the things that residents of Middleport, a quaint Niagara County village nestled against the historic Erie Canal, really enjoy. Middleport has affordable homes loaded with charm, beautiful parks, playgrounds and restaurants. In the Village, trips to the library, post office, running track, tennis courts, school, medical center, banks, churches, and post office are all within walking distance. Residents have more time to enjoy daily life.
